El Paso County Parks Celebrate 50 Years

January 13, 2021– May 4, 2021 marks the 50th anniversary of El Paso County Parks when County residents approved the establishment of the park system. El Paso County Parks began as an answer to a community need to provide increased access to outdoor recreation opportunities and open spaces for citizens of all ages and backgrounds…

Public Requested to Review Jones Park Master Plan Draft and Survey

December 9, 2020 – El Paso County Parks is seeking public review and survey participation regarding the draft Jones Park Master Plan. Popular for multiple outdoor recreation pursuits and beautiful scenery, Jones Park is also home of the federally threatened Greenback Cutthroat Trout.
